The magnetic properties of nanoparticles (NPs) are affected by interperticle interactions. Thus, formation of magnetic NPs-based periodic structure enables us to control and modulate the their properties. However, it is quite difficult to form such magnetic NPs-based structure because magnetic NPs tend to aggregate due to their strong interactions. Thus, we focused our attention on thermotropic liquid crystalline dendrons with self-assembling property. In this study, we developed the dendron-modified Fe3O4 NPs with a thick dendron layer. The self-assembling behavior and the temperature-dependent structural ordering of the resulting dendron-modified NPs has been investigated.
